2011 Open Canoe Slalom Nationals and North American Champion

The 2011 ACA Open Canoe Slalom Nationals & North American Championships that were to be held on July 6-8, 2011 at the Clear Creek Whitewater Park in Golden, CO, have been canceled due to the anticipation of very high water at the race site on the schedule race weekend! The American Open needs Volunteers

Paddlers: The American Open, a Canoe-Slalom World Series Race, that is scheduled for Friday and Saturday, October 3rd & 4th, 2008, at ASCI in Western Maryland and is looking for volunteers to help run the race.
